How to protect a golf cap from sweat stains?

Protect your golf cap from sweat stains by treating it with a fabric protector. It helps keep your cap from absorbing dirt and sweat. Unfold the sweatband from your golf cap so the sweatband is hanging out of the cap. Spray an aerosol fabric protector on the inside and outside of the golf cap.

Why do my baseball pants have black stains on them?

As opposed to the green stains from natural grass, when baseball players fall and slide on artificial turf, they get gooey black turf stains on their white baseball pants. These can be hard to get rid of using just water.

What causes yellow stains on white pants?

The combination of perspiration and aluminium elements found in most antiperspirants and deodorants cause the yellow stains to appear. Avoid washing the stain in hot water, as this will cause the stain to set.

How do you keep white clothes white without bleach?

Pour about one-quarter cup of vinegar into your washing machine's bleach dispenser before running a load or in the fabric softener dispenser for the final rinse cycle. If your whites need some more help, try soaking them for a few hours in water and one cup of white vinegar before washing.

How do you stop colors from bleeding in clothes?

Add 1 cup of vinegar to the rinse cycle or one-half cup salt to the wash to help hold in colors. Use color-catcher sheets, which trap extraneous dyes during the wash cycle to prevent bleeding. Don't overstuff your dryer. Clothes will dry faster.

How to get artificial turf off of baseball pants?

Here’s how you use rubbing alcohol to clean artificial turf stains off of white baseball pants: 1) First, mix together some water and rubbing alcohol in a small bowl until the mixture is 50% water and 50% rubbing alcohol by volume (i.e., 1 cup water + 1/2 cup rubbing alcohol). 2) Next, soak an old washcloth or rag with the solution ...

Why is my baseball field black?

The reason for these stubborn black stains lies in the infill that is used in artificial turf for sports and baseball fields. The turf infill that causes these stains comes from rubber, which is petroleum/oil based. So its stains can be very difficult to do away with.

What soap to use on white baseball pants?

Fels-Naptha Laundry Soap Bar is still a good option for helping remove turf stains out of white baseball pants because of its new advanced formula that has the ability to tackle grease and oil stains efficiently.
